It Has My Face
I’ve noticed the ‘Kill anyone in a hectic position’ facet of It Has My Face – prior to now referred to as DoubleWe – draw in comparisons to Hitman. Honest sufficient. Apart from right here, you’re now not a genetically enhanced grasp murderer yet a random schmuck, compelled to arm your self with scavenged bats and shitty one-shot revolvers, and your goal isn’t milling about in a glass-bottomed scorching bath dangling over a cliff. They know who you might be and why you might be right here, and are actively looking you again, in a position to price thru a throng of civs if it way shanking you earlier than you shank them.
This relative energy stability makes for some deliciously irritating rounds of hardcore hide-and-seek, as does the effectiveness with which It Has My Face cranks up the paranoia. Crowds are ceaselessly thick sufficient to difficult to understand a dashing goal, and your most effective way of figuring out them within the open is to drag out a reflect and test your personal mirrored image (they’ve your face, y’see). Between common reflect reminders, the sketchy actions of NPCs lookalikes, and the uncomfortably very long time it takes to free up a weapon crate, It Has My Face skilfully splits your consideration clear of the real risk, ceaselessly proper as much as the purpose they’re elevating the knife. And the one feeling more potent that that boiling anxiety is the relaxation that comes from being sooner at the draw.
It is just introduced in early get admission to, so the overall tale mode and multiplayer options aren’t in position but, yet I’ve very a lot loved having my nerves shredded by way of It Has My Face in its present state. There’s a Steam demo to take a look at, should you’re not sure.
Bounce Area
Oh no, it’s any other early get admission to sport, and – by contrast to the deliberately low-fi It Has My Face – one whose unsanded edges are visibly coated in possible splinters. Bounce Area’s Sea-of-Thieves-but-you’re-in-space is prickly with thorns. Repetitive undertaking varieties. Garbage (despite the fact that allegedly placeholder) AI voices. Jukeboxes that now and again malicious program out and get started sounding like they’re blasting rock tunes now not simply from out of doors your spaceship’s rec room, yet from out of doors the send itself.
All of the identical, I stay coming again to Bounce Area, as a lot for its goofy appeal because the gunslinging rocketship adventures that shape its central delusion. This can be a sport the place plans fall aside and necessary tools explode, yet in most cases in slapstick, non-punitive ways in which give the affect that the builders are in at the funny story. A teammate stumbling their manner off a cliff in, say, Left 4 Lifeless, can break a complete run; right here, while you spherical a nook to look all the bridge engulfed in flames, the unaware pilot this-is-fine-ing their manner into the crosshairs of any other enemy gunship, it is simply… humorous.
Bounce Area is not a dumb sport, thoughts. A few of its raid varieties may also be relatively suave in how they unfold out targets to successfully break up your group up, elevating the stakes by way of forcing flooring groups to struggle with out backup whilst a skeleton team keep within the send to verify it’s not blown out of the sky within the period in-between. This becoming a member of of flight and on-foot motion is one thing that a number of area video games have tried, yet few have realised so seamlessly, and I am prepared to look what else Bounce Area can succeed in because it continues to building up and outwards.
Lushfoil Images Sim
I will be able to’t take into account why Graham (RPS in peace) requested me to evaluation Lushfoil Images Sim; perhaps he’d been having a look at my SSD photos and concept “Christ, this man wishes to be informed about focal period.”
Smartly, be informed I did, as a result of it is a simulator and a trainer each. That’s no small success when the subject material is as thickly plastered with jargon as pictures is, yet Lushfoil patiently and successfully demystifies the entire F-stop and ISO gibberish, then places you and a digital camera in entrance of a few of Earth’s greatest surroundings for some sensible courses. The outcome: wowzers, I if truth be told perceive what my DSLR’s buttons and switches do now. Would any person rent me for his or her wedding ceremony? Most certainly now not. However I’d argue I will be able to be relied on to take footage greater than anyone with twelve hours in iRacing may well be relied on with a Ferrari.
Let’s now not gloss over simply how picturebook-spectacular the ones locales are, both. If simulating pictures is Lushfoil’s first precedence, and educating it the second one, then the 3rd is unquestionably celebrating Mom Nature in all her wild, snowy, leafy, sunny, sweeping splendour. It’s simple to change into so ensconced in those mountains and forests, they all constructed to seize the wanderlusty spirit of real-life opposite numbers, that you find yourself forgetting to take any footage. You must, despite the fact that. It’s possible you’ll be informed one thing.
